Handover — Graphwright visualizer (to release manager)

Okwe, before cutover: the dependency graph visualizer now renders the full Larkspur build tree, but cycles are flagged, not blocked — please gate the release on zero flagged cycles. Cache rebuilds take ~40 minutes, so schedule them off-peak. The admin panel locked me out once; if that happens, recover access with the passphrase just below.

vault phrase of hafog-fafof = ulaix-ralath

Minutes — Management Meeting, Gross-Margin Review

Attendees: T. Varnholt (Chair), R. Okimbe, S. Brann. The committee reviewed Q3 gross margins across the Fennick and Larode lines, noting a 2.1-point decline attributable to freight and packaging costs. Corrective pricing actions were approved for January. Mitigation options were debated at length and will be tracked monthly. The strategic implications are set out in the confidential note below.

internal memo for kaguf-yajog: Headcount on the Druath team goes from 30 to 70 by the end of November. Gross margin on Druath came in at 56 percent against a plan of 28 percent.

Subject: DR Drill — PedalShift Rebalancer

Team,

Drill is Friday 09:00. We'll kill the primary dispatch node for the PedalShift rebalancing tool and fail over to the Corvan standby. Release freeze from Thursday noon. Confirm truck-routing jobs drain cleanly before cutover. Restoring the standby's sealed config store requires the recovery passphrase given below.

—Ines

vault phrase of tajef-tafog = istox-sorax-zorox-casok-holox-kelix-weneth-drueth-casion

# TailScope Environments

TailScope is our internal CLI for tailing service logs across clusters. Plugin authors should note that each environment (dev, staging, production) exposes a distinct streaming endpoint and retention policy, and plugins must honor the per-environment rate limits or risk throttling. Behavior is otherwise identical across environments. For reference, the configuration values currently applied in each environment are shown below.

settings of fafog-haduf:
ZORIX_PIN=4648
ZORIX_METRICS_HOST=metrics.zorix.paliqsys.corp
ZORIX_LOG_LEVEL=info
ZORIX_TENANT=druix